STEAMBOAT SPRINGS, COLO. – Corbin Carpenter led the University of Alaska Anchorage ski team with a fifth-place finish in the 20-kilometer freestyle at the Colorado Invitational Friday.
He covered the course in 57:41.
Erling Bjornstad was the second Seawolf to finish in the top-10 finishing ninth in 58:07.
Dashe McCabe was the top finisher for the Seawolf women placing 11th in 1:12:41.
Marit Flora was 16th (1:16:51), and Alexandra Otto was 19th (1:17:25).
Hedda Halvari was 22nd (1:18:51), Constance Lapointe 24th (1:21:31) and Marlie Molinaro 25th (1:22:01).
Other finishes for the men included Parke Chapin 19th (1:01:13), Hermod Bangstad 21st (1:01:48), Garrett Siever 22nd (1:03:26) and Matt Seline 24th (1:07:14).
The Seawolves are currently fifth out of nine teams.
Utah won both races with Zachary Jayne winning the men's (57:03) and Erica Laven winning the women's (1:06:51).
The Colorado Invitational concludes Saturday with the 7.5-kilometer classic race.
